Biodiversity (Conservation) of Plums In Slavonia Through Tradition of Plum Brandy Making
Traditional plum cultivars, grown in Slavonia, represent a mixture of several species or subspecies, including: European plum (P. domestica L.), mirabelles (P. insititia var. syriaca L.), and damsons (P. insititia var. damascena L.). First plum orchards were planted in the 3th and 4th century near the river Sava and Drava by Roman emperors. Plum brandy has been produced for 300 years and made with traditional varieties of plums. The production of plum brandy “Slavonska šljivovica” has significantly contributed to the preservation of traditional plum cultivars in Slavonia, whereas the fruits of these genotypes are used for distillation. It is believed that these traditional cultivars provide characteristic aroma and authenticity of traditional plum brandy. In Slavonia between the years of 1885 and 1890, average plum yield was 672, 631 metric cents (1 m.c. = 100 kg). In 1885 production of plum brandy was 27, 163 hl, and in 1890 4 453 hl. This long-term production and the traditional way of plum cultivation have resulted with high genetic and morphological diversity of plums that have been grown in Slavonia. In the experimental orchard of the Institute of Pomology (Croatian Centre for Agriculture, Food and Rural Affairs), located in Donja Zelina, Croatia, 18 of analysed varieties have been planted. The same are registered in the List of varieties of fruit species and five of them are going to be included in process of production of plant material e.g. buds for grafting.
